Dementia diagnosis and utilization patterns in a racially diverse population within an integrated health care delivery system.

Huong Q NguyenSoo BorsonPeter KhangAnnette Langer-GouldSusan E WangJarrod CarrolJanet S Lee
Published in: Alzheimer's & dementia (New York, N. Y.) (2022)
Similar to other MA plans, ADRD is under-diagnosed in this health system, compared to traditional Medicare, and diagnosed well beyond the early stages, when opportunities to improve overall outcomes are presumed to be better. Dementia specialists function primarily as consultants whose care does not appear to mitigate acute care use. Strategic targets for ADRD care improvement could focus on generating pragmatic evidence on the value of proactive detection and tracking, care planning, and the role of specialists in chronic care management.
